As cyber threats continue to evolve, government agencies must adopt advanced cybersecurity technologies to stay ahead of potential attacks. Solutions such as artificial intelligence (AI) and machine learning (ML) are gaining traction in the cybersecurity landscape, enabling agencies to analyze vast amounts of data and identify anomalies indicative of potential breaches. These technologies enhance threat detection capabilities and streamline incident response processes, allowing agencies to respond more efficiently to emerging threats.

In 2026, IAM solutions will likely incorporate advanced technologies such as biometrics and multi-factor authentication (MFA), further enhancing security measures. MFA, in particular, adds an additional layer of security by requiring users to provide multiple forms of verification before accessing sensitive resources. This approach not only strengthens security but also instills greater confidence among stakeholders regarding data protectio

Additionally, organizations should continuously monitor their systems for suspicious activity. Implementing security information and event management (SIEM) solutions can enhance monitoring efforts by aggregating and analyzing security data from multiple sources. This proactive approach helps organizations quickly detect and respond to potential threats, ensuring compliance and reducing risk

Cloud computing security services refer to the frameworks, technologies, and controls that organizations implement to protect their data and applications hosted in the cloud. These services are designed to safeguard against unauthorized access, data breaches, and other cyber threats. Cloud security encompasses various components, including data encryption, identity management, and network security protocols. Understanding these services is crucial for any organization looking to transition to or enhance its existing cloud infrastructur
